How they compare
Qatar currently reports 61,476 number against 56,145 number in Djibouti, a difference of 5,331 number.
That makes Qatar's figure about 1.1 times Djibouti's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 48 shared years of data; in 1970 it was Djibouti ahead.
Djibouti ranks 153rd and Qatar ranks 151st of 205 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Djibouti averaged higher in 5 and Qatar in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Djibouti | Qatar |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 15,626 number | 6,463 number | 9,164 number | Djibouti |
| 1980s | 32,952 number | 12,346 number | 20,606 number | Djibouti |
| 1990s | 49,517 number | 19,872 number | 29,646 number | Djibouti |
| 2000s | 61,765 number | 26,897 number | 34,868 number | Djibouti |
| 2010s | 57,322 number | 44,968 number | 12,354 number | Djibouti |
| 2020s | 56,145 number | 61,476 number | 5,331 number | Qatar |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
